Dishes
Hot Pot with Whole IngredientsA hot pot dish featuring various vegetables and meats, commonly including pork, tofu, cabbage, carrots, and mushrooms. Ingredients are cut into pieces, placed in a clay pot with broth or water, and slowly simmered over low heat until flavorful and tender.
Beef Meatball Hot PotBeef meatball hot pot made with fresh beef balls, vegetables, and broth simmered slowly in a clay pot. Main ingredients include beef, potato, carrot, and cabbage, blended through gentle cooking.
Sausage Hot PotRed sausage stew features sliced red sausage with potatoes, cabbage, and tofu, slowly simmered in a clay pot. The flavors blend as the sausage and vegetables heat together, creating a rich, savory broth.
